12-3-1.1. Residents of federal areas.No person residing on an area within the boundaries of this state which has been ceded to, or acquired by, the federal government shall be denied the right to vote in elections of this state or of the county, municipality, school district, or special district wherein such area lies if such person is otherwise qualified to vote in such election or elections. Source: SL 1970, ch 92.
